Word: Paronomastic
Speech Type: Adjective
Etymology:
early 19th century; earliest use found in Samuel Taylor Coleridge (1772–1834), poet, critic, and philosopher. From para- + onomastic, after paronomasia
Definition:
Of or relating to paronomasia; characterized by paronomasia, punning.
Variant Forms:
- paranomastic
